Nationally important collection of British art from the 17th century onward, including the Norwich School painters, in a refined historic setting.
Beautifully preserved merchant’s house showing domestic life through furnished rooms and period collections across several centuries.
Historic market operating in the city centre for centuries. Lively, colorful, and ideal for soaking up Norwich’s daily atmosphere.
Characterful cobbled lane lined with independent shops and medieval buildings. One of Norwich’s most photographed and atmospheric streets.
Riverside green space beside the cathedral with peaceful walks, open lawns, and excellent views of the historic precinct.
A strongly flavoured blue cheese from Norfolk, prized for its creamy texture and historic local production. Often served on cheese boards or in sauces.
Traditional Norfolk cured ham, usually sliced thin and valued for its local heritage. A classic in sandwiches, ploughman’s lunches, and pub meals.
Locally landed brown crab from the Norfolk coast, known for sweet meat and freshness. Commonly served dressed or in seafood platters.

Moderate for the UK: hotels and dining are lower than London, while buses, pubs, and casual meals are manageable for most city visitors.
Service is sometimes included in restaurants; if not, 10-12.5% is common for good service. Taxi fares can be rounded up. Tipping in cafes is optional.
